LOS ANGELES (KABC) -- The cleanup continued in a Boyle Heights neighborhood after sudden rains swallowed cars and left behind a muddy mess.

The big problem: Storm drains clogged with trash and debris.

Officials said a mattress clogged a catch basin on Bernal Avenue, causing dozens of cars to go under water and some basements to flood on Monday.

With El Nino arriving this winter, officials with the Los Angeles Public Works Department are asking neighbors to be diligent to prevent flooding.

You are asked to search your yard for things that could potentially be washed away and block storm drains.

Also, you can check the catch basins on your street. If they are blocked or clogged, you can call public works at (323) 342-6006.
